Check you have no other devices (OR SOFTWARE / DRIVERS) that act as or emulate joysticks. This includes other controllers, pedals, gaming keyboards, eye tracking / head tracking peripherals or software like vjoy that emulates joysticks in other games. Go into settings for usb devices, type joystick into the find a setting box and click on set up USB game controllers - it should then list your current joysticks). Disconnect all other usb devices except keyboard, mouse and joystick and reboot and then see if the game recognises it.
This happens because windows assigns a number / order to things it thinks are joysticks (and your actual joystick is not necessarily the first device detected) and SOME games / game engines just detect the first device in the list, even if its not your actual controller.
